City of Spooner receives $119,000 state grant to support a new green space
A $119,000 Community Development Investment Grant from the Wisconsin Economic Development Corporation (WEDC) will allow the city of Spooner to transform a former post office into a green space that will link the city’s downtown with two museums, a developing railroad-themed park and a recreational trail.
City of Sun Prairie receives $250,000 state grant to support redevelopment of downtown property
A $250,000 grant from the Wisconsin Economic Development Corporation (WEDC) will help the City of Sun Prairie recover from a 2018 natural gas explosion by relocating Glass Nickel Pizza downtown and adding 10 new apartments.

Wisconsin ginseng celebrated in joint event with Taiwanese trade officials
Wisconsin farmers have been growing ginseng for more than a century, and in fact, ginseng grown in Wisconsin accounts for more than 90% of all ginseng produced in the U.S.--with central Wisconsin at the epicenter due to its cool summers, long winter, clean water and virgin soil, and Marathon County producing 95% of Wisconsin’s crop.
